The Bayou Classic TB650 is a robust outdoor patio stove featuring a 13-inch tall welded steel frame, three 6-inch high-pressure burners with brass manifold and control valves, and an expansive cooking surface that extends up to 60.5 inches with side shelves. Designed to handle large pots up to 62 quarts, it offers adjustable height and precise heat control, making it the ultimate choice for serious outdoor chefs and entertainers.

Great burner for making maple syrup!
This is a very powerful burner. It was able to bring a 18" x 36" stainless steel pan half full to a full boil in 7 minutes. Using it to evaporate maple sap for syrup. Uses a pretty good amount of propane per hour, but produces a lot of heat in return.

ALMOST perfect!
I purchased mine 5 years ago, I do several fish frys a year, including one that goes for 8 hours that I cook 1600 pieces of fish and 550oz of fries for. That's a serious workout for a fryer, but this unit handles it great. I've ran 3 pots on it several times, and never had a problem. I'm actually considering buying a new one and letting a good friend have my old one.Advantages:1. Needle valves work pretty good. Open wide to get temp up, then throttle back to maintain temp. Usually by third batch of fish I've got the temp settled in nicely, and maybe adjust each pot every 3rd batch or so.2. Lightweight enough that I easily lift it over the side of my 3/4 ton truck.3. Sturdy considering the weight. I've never bent anything on mine.4. Those solid little side tables are awesome. You might not think you'll use them, but give them a shot.5. Plenty of BTU's in each burner.6. I guess that's powdercoating on the fryer. Not sure, but it's held up well for 5 years now.Drawbacks:1. If you're running short 6" pots for fish or a griddle top on it, it's about 6-8 inches too short for a 5'10" person. My 5'4" wife feels like it's about right.2. Although it WILL get oil temp up to 325 degrees on 3 pots in a stiff breeze, you have to really crank the valves open to do it. My propane bottle will sweat pretty hard during this. A little more wind protection would be good.3. Running 2 burners for 5 hours WILL empty a full 20# propane bottle. 3 burners does it in a little over 3.5 hours. Propane isn't THAT expensive that I feel the need to complain, I'm just saying that for extended duty be sure to have a full spare.4. Regulator failed in third year during the middle of my big fish fry with no warning at all. Luckily there was a propane store 15 minutes away so I was only down about 45 minutes. A spare is like 15 bucks. BUY ONE AND PUT IT IN YOUR FRY KIT. (Don't forget the appropriate sized socket and wrench to change it. And teflon tape...)All in all, a fine unit. I just haven't ever understood why the don't call it a FRYER instead of a stove. It definitely has the BTU's to handle the job.

Wonderful
The Bayou Classic Triple Burner (TB650) was exactly what I was looking for. The consturction is solid. The burners work like a dream with separate controls for each that is easily controled. The only drawback is that the description says that it can handle 3 60 qt pots, but my 60 qt pot has a large diameter and too much over hang. 40 qt pots work much better.

Pay attention:
Company did not prepare stove for shipping, all brass threads were damaged and had to be cleaned up with a 3 corner file. Air vent for burners do not have a accesible location for the two screws, which are placed at 12 oclock and 6 oclock, which interfere with the brass fittings for propane, should be 3-9 oclock. Stove is way toooooo low for normal use and I will have to make longer legs.Now once I have corrected most of thier ineptness, the stove does perform, all burners produce a nice clean flame both hi or low burn. I will also add wind protection to cut down on heat loss/required to maintain temperature. But the simple things really agg my butt...PROTECT BRASS THREADS FOR SHIPPING! MAKE ALL SCREWS AVAILABLE FOR ADJUSTMENT!!! PUT LOOSE SCREWS IN A BAGGY, NOT TAPED TO A LEG!!! ADD 10 INCHES TO THE LEGS TO MAKE IT A NORMAL STOVE HEIGHT!!
